Arts & Culture: Capturing and Celebrating the “Manila of Old & New” at the Purveyr-OPPO Photowalk in Binondo

Sponsor Digicon

MANILA, PHILIPPINES — Walking through the beautiful streets of Binondo, Manila is an adventure all on its own that often requires sharp eyes and a curious mind to discover all its wonders. Last Saturday, August 31, Purveyr and OPPO hosted a photowalk to honor and celebrate this as it brought together a group of impassioned photographers through the corners and alleys of the world’s oldest Chinatown. 

The “Manila of Old & New” photowalk event had 4 Filipino professional photographers — Martin San Diego, Jilson Tiu, Rainier Gonzalez and Al Amin — mentor fifteen young photographers steadily entering the photography community and equipped them with the latest technology of the OPPO Reno smartphone to capture anything of interest in their own distinct ways.

Through the event, the beautiful and unique Binondo experience was able to be celebrated and memorialized even more under the leadership of Purveyr and OPPO. They successfully provided an avenue for young and veteran Filipino photographers to learn, inspire and collaborate with one another to further strengthen and uplift the local photography community.
